[Çözüldü] LocalHost'a Joomla ve Phpbb3 kurma sorunu?

Başlatan doe, 16 Şubat 2010 - 20:42:57

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

doe

Merhabalar. Ufak bir sorunum var ve çözüm arıyorum.

SUDO dergisinin son sayısında anlatıldığı üzere bilgisayarıma joomla kurmak için mysql ve apache2 kurdum.

var/www altına gerekli dosyaları attım ancak joomla kurulumuna geçilemiyor malesef. ve şöyle bir hata veriyor;

Alıntı Yap
Warning: require_once(/var/www/joomla/includes/defines.php) [function.require-once]: failed to open stream: Permission denied in /var/www/joomla/index.php on line 21

Fatal error: require_once() [function.require]: Failed opening required '/var/www/joomla/includes/defines.php' (include_path='.:/usr/share/php:/usr/share/pear') in /var/www/joomla/index.php on line 21

yine var/www altına phpbb3 kurmak istediğimde ise şu hatayı veriyor;

Alıntı YapForbidden

You don't have permission to access /phpbb3/install/index.php on this server.
Apache/2.2.12 (Ubuntu) Server at localhost Port 80

Bu problemleri nasıl çözebilirim?

teşekkürler.

raspacı

Kurulum belgelerinde anlatılan izinleri gerekli dosyalara vermeniz lazım sanırım. Bazı dosyalara erişim izninizolmadığını söylüyor.
nereye gidersen git kendini de götürürsün.

doe

Evet yasak diyor ama nereyi nasıl değiştirmem konusunda bir bilgi yok. Varsa da ben bulamadım. Ancak normalde ben bu dosyaları şuan ftpden sunucuya atsam hiç bir değişiklik olmadan kesin çalışır.

posted


şunları gözden geçirin ltf ;

joomla için :

http://www.cmsturk.net/forum/showthread.php?t=14659

phpbb3 için :

http://www.phpbb.com/kb/article/phpbb3-chmod-permissions/


ancak phpbb3 kurulumu için zaten sizden daha kurulum ekranında şu şu şu dosyaların ya da folderlerin izinlerini düzenleyin diyor, eger siz daha oralara gelemeden üstteki hatayı alıyorsanız bunlardan önce apacheyi basit şekliyle çalıştırmalısınız, çalıştırıyorsanız sorun yok..
örnegin : benimdomainim/test.html  gibi..

By_Mihni

Kurmuşsunuzdur kesin ama ben gene de sormak istiyorum. Php5 kurulumu yaptınız mı peki.

raspacı

Normalde var/www ye erişim yasaktır. Sen muhtemelen root halkarıyla girip kaydettin ama php çalışırken dosyayı çalıştıramıyor demekki. Sudo da dosya izinlerinde sudo chmod 777 /var/www/joomla/configuration.php -R ifadesi verilmiş. olmadıysa www yolunun izinlerini toptan değiştirebilirsin de. Aslında ev dizinine bir www dizini oluşturup işlemlerioradan da halledebilirsin. Bunun için wiki de bir anlatım vardı. http://wiki.ubuntu-tr.net/index.php5/Apache_Kurulumu_ve_Kullan%C4%B1m%C4%B1  işte burada.  var/www için ise;
sudo chmod 777 -R /var/www işlemi ile okuma yazma iznini verip joomlayı tekrar kurmayı dene belki işe yarar. Ama en iyisi sudodaki anlatımdaki izinleri dikkatlice uygulamaktır.
nereye gidersen git kendini de götürürsün.

doe

#6
Yukarıdaki hataları daha kurulum ekranı gelmeden alıyorum. Yani dosyaları attım var/www içerisine ve ardından tarayıcı vasıtasıyla

Localhost/joomla(klasörün ismi) yahut phpbb3 yazıyorum ancak yukarıdaki hataları veriyor.

Ayrıca php5 kurdum. Zaten kurulumu sudo şubat sayısını referans alarak gerçekleştirdim;


apache2 için;
sudo apt-get install apache2

mysql için;
sudo apt-get install php5 php5-mysql mysql-server

sanırım bu şekilde kurulmuş olması gerekiyor.


Mesaj tekrarı yüzünden mesajınız birleştirildi. Bu mesajın gönderim tarihi : 16 Şubat 2010 - 21:31:11

Alıntı yapılan: levi - 16 Şubat 2010 - 21:16:44
Normalde var/www ye erişim yasaktır. Sen muhtemelen root halkarıyla girip kaydettin ama php çalışırken dosyayı çalıştıramıyor demekki. Sudo da dosya izinlerinde sudo chmod 777 /var/www/joomla/configuration.php -R ifadesi verilmiş. olmadıysa www yolunun izinlerini toptan değiştirebilirsin de. Aslında ev dizinine bir www dizini oluşturup işlemlerioradan da halledebilirsin. Bunun için wiki de bir anlatım vardı. http://wiki.ubuntu-tr.net/index.php5/Apache_Kurulumu_ve_Kullan%C4%B1m%C4%B1  işte burada.  var/www için ise;
sudo chmod 777 -R /var/www işlemi ile okuma yazma iznini verip joomlayı tekrar kurmayı dene belki işe yarar. Ama en iyisi sudodaki anlatımdaki izinleri dikkatlice uygulamaktır.

levi dostum sen birtanesin. :)

sudo chmod 777 -R /var/www

ile sorun çözüldü. :)

Vallahi bu ubuntu'ya geçtiğimden beri ne soruyorsam anında cevap bulabiliyorum. Yahut aradığım bilgilere sadece bu siteye girmekle ulaşabiliyorum. Linux ile mutluyum.  :D


raspacı

Rica ederim ; Çalışmalarında kolaylıklar...
nereye gidersen git kendini de götürürsün.

By_Mihni